Many wondered how Jennifer Aniston would deal with the news that ex hubby Brad Pitt and Angelina Jolie had their baby in Africa.  It seems she took her boyfriend Vince Vaughn's advice and once again emerged as the bigger person.

Call it the Vaughn influence.  According to a report from Life & Style Weekly Jennifer phoned the couple and gave them a hearty congratulations.

Good for her.

The magazine reports:

“Jen got the news late on Saturday afternoon,” a source close to the actress tells Life & Style. “And at first she was really surprised because she had heard it was going to be a boy. After some debate with Vince Jen decided to call Brad’s manager and give congratulations from them both.

“I think Jen is really proud of herself for swallowing her pride and getting over her personal feelings to pass on her best wishes to the whole family. But Jen also says she’s as curious as anyone else to see what the baby looks like, and for her, that’s where the real suspense is!”

An earlier report had claimed that Vince told Jen to deal with the issue head on and Jennifer reportedly remains very close with Brad's mom and his entire family. 

It is a good move personally and public relations wise to congratulate the couple on the birth.

Remember - GQ was so impressed on how Jennifer emerged as the bigger person during the entire messy divorce they gave her 'Man of the Year' honors for her maturity and class.

This won't hurt that reputation.
